信即时通讯云如何应对大规模用户访问?
随着互联网技术的飞速发展,即时通讯(IM)已成为人们日常交流的重要工具。然而,随着用户数量的激增,如何应对大规模用户访问成为即时通讯云服务提供商面临的一大挑战。本文将从以下几个方面探讨信即时通讯云如何应对大规模用户访问。
一、优化网络架构
- 多级缓存机制
为了提高数据访问速度,信即时通讯云采用多级缓存机制。通过在用户端、服务器端以及边缘节点部署缓存,实现数据快速读取。同时,根据用户访问频率,动态调整缓存策略,确保热门数据始终处于缓存状态。
- 分布式部署
信即时通讯云采用分布式部署,将服务器资源分散至全球多个数据中心。这样,当用户访问时,可以就近选择服务器,降低延迟,提高访问速度。
- 负载均衡
通过负载均衡技术,信即时通讯云可以将用户请求均匀分配到各个服务器,避免单点过载,提高系统稳定性。此外,负载均衡还可以根据服务器性能动态调整请求分配策略,确保系统高效运行。
二、优化数据存储
- 分布式存储
信即时通讯云采用分布式存储技术,将用户数据分散存储于多个服务器,提高数据安全性。同时,分布式存储可以应对大规模数据访问,保证数据读写速度。
- 数据压缩与加密
为了减少数据传输量,信即时通讯云对数据进行压缩处理。同时,采用加密技术,确保数据传输过程中的安全性。
- 数据备份与恢复
信即时通讯云定期对用户数据进行备份,防止数据丢失。同时,提供快速恢复机制,确保在数据丢失后能够迅速恢复。
三、提升系统性能
- 高并发处理
信即时通讯云采用高性能服务器和分布式架构,实现高并发处理。通过优化算法,降低系统资源消耗,提高系统性能。
- 智能路由
信即时通讯云根据用户地理位置、网络状况等因素,智能选择最优路由,降低延迟,提高访问速度。
- 容灾备份
信即时通讯云在多个数据中心部署容灾备份系统,确保在主数据中心发生故障时,能够快速切换至备用数据中心,保证系统稳定运行。
四、提升用户体验
- 个性化推荐
信即时通讯云通过分析用户行为,为用户提供个性化推荐,提高用户活跃度。
- 智能客服
信即时通讯云提供智能客服功能,用户可以随时咨询问题,提高服务质量。
- 丰富的功能模块
信即时通讯云提供语音、视频、图文等多种通讯方式,满足用户多样化的需求。
五、安全防护
- 防火墙与入侵检测
信即时通讯云部署防火墙和入侵检测系统,防止恶意攻击和非法访问。
- 数据安全
信即时通讯云采用数据加密、访问控制等技术,确保用户数据安全。
- 事故应急响应
信即时通讯云建立事故应急响应机制,确保在发生安全事故时,能够迅速采取措施,降低损失。
总之,信即时通讯云通过优化网络架构、数据存储、系统性能、用户体验和安全防护等方面,有效应对大规模用户访问。在未来,信即时通讯云将继续努力,为用户提供更加优质、高效、安全的即时通讯服务。
猜你喜欢:IM场景解决方案